PCBA lead time control is a key factor in enhancing customer satisfaction and maintaining competitive advantages in the electronics manufacturing industry. Lead time, which covers the entire process from order placement to product delivery, is affected by multiple links, including component procurement, production scheduling, and quality inspection. Enterprises need to establish a comprehensive lead time management mechanism to optimize each link and shorten the overall lead time.
Component procurement is a major bottleneck in PCBA lead time. To address this, enterprises can establish long-term cooperative relationships with core component suppliers to ensure the stability and timeliness of supply. Additionally, conducting supplier evaluation and selection regularly helps improve the reliability of the supply chain. For key components with long procurement cycles, enterprises can adopt a strategic stockpiling strategy to avoid delays caused by supply shortages.
Optimizing production scheduling is another effective measure to control PCBA lead time. By using production planning and scheduling software, enterprises can reasonably arrange production tasks, balance the load of production equipment and personnel, and reduce production waiting time. Simultaneously, strengthening process management and improving production efficiency through lean production methods (such as eliminating waste and optimizing workflow) can further shorten the production cycle. Strict quality inspection during the production process is also necessary to avoid rework and reprocessing caused by quality problems, which can significantly extend lead time.
